I think there was a recent change in 7.5.0 to attempt to find new artwork 
during a scan for new/changed files.

Well, potentially relating to that, I can report that it doesn't work if you 
browse to a song where the album doesn't have artwork.

i.e. when browsing to a song, it reads changed tags, but artwork fetching in 
this way is iffy.  Sequence of steps:

1. I had run a scan for new/changed albums
2. It detected a few new albums since my last scan, but I had forgotten to 
store artwork for one album, and I also noticed a typo in the album name.
3. I changed the album name tag for each song, and added a folder.jpg in the 
folder.
4. I browsed down into song info for each song on the album.
5. This caused it to re-read tags for each song.
6. The album name is correctly displayed in the New Music list, and the album 
is first in the list.  The album artwork thumbnail is displayed in this list.
7. Browsing into the album displays the correct album name, but the artwork is 
not displayed (even after refreshing the page in the browser).
8. Browsing to songs on the album shows the correct album name, but the artwork 
is not displayed.
9. Browsing into View Tags for each song shows the correct tags, but not the 
artwork.

Incidentally, I get the opposite effect with another new album - the artwork 
isn't displayed in New Music, but is displayed when I browse the album or songs 
on the album.
